Sons of Legion Concert Live at The Fillmore | Detroit – September 15th, 2026
The Fillmore in Detroit is one of those legendary spots that just oozes history and good vibes. It’s hosted everything from epic concerts to comedy shows featuring some of the biggest names in the game. You might have caught a performance by legendary acts or even seen a comedy legend crack up the crowd, this place has seen it all. Its stunning architecture, with ornate details and a rich past, even earned it a spot on the national historic registry, which is pretty cool. Located right in the heart of downtown, it’s super easy to find whether you’re coming from the riverside or the city center. The main floor orchestra seats are right up front, giving you that immersive experience that makes you feel like you’re part of the show. Plus, they’ve got disability-friendly seating so everyone can enjoy the magic.
